Title: Seon-Ju Lim: Innovator in Hierarchical Zeolites
Introduction
Seon-Ju Lim is a prominent inventor based in Daejeon, South Korea. He has made significant contributions to the field of materials science, particularly in the development of hierarchical zeolites. With a total of 2 patents, his work focuses on innovative methods for preparing zeolites that enhance their activity and efficiency.
Latest Patents
Seon-Ju Lim's latest patents include two notable inventions. The first patent, titled "Hierarchical zeolites and preparation method therefor," describes a method for preparing hierarchical zeolites. This method involves several steps, including the preparation of a first mixture solution with a structure-directing agent, an alumina precursor, and a pH controller. The process continues with the injection of a silica precursor into the first mixture, followed by the addition of an aqueous solution containing a surfactant. The final steps include drying and heat-treating the third mixture solution. This invention allows for the creation of hierarchical zeolites with a uniform morphology, resulting in improved activity.
The second patent, "Hierarchical EU-2 type zeolite having both micropores and mesopores, and preparation method therefor," outlines a method for preparing hierarchical zeolite. This method involves a reaction of a mixture containing water, a silica precursor, an alumina precursor, a pH adjustment material, and at least one structure-inducing material along with a surfactant. The drying and heat treatment steps follow the reaction. This innovative approach results in zeolites that possess both micropores and mesopores, enhancing their functional properties.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Seon-Ju Lim has worked with notable companies, including SK Innovation Co., Ltd. and SK Lubricants Co., Ltd.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in zeolite research and development.
Collaborations
Seon-Ju Lim has collaborated with talented individuals in his field, including Young-Eun Cheon and Tae-Jin Kim. These collaborations have fostered innovation and advancement in zeolite technology.
